Cryptology: The Mathematics of Secrecy
the science of secure communication, uses mathematical techniques to encrypt and decrypt messages
published : 29 March 2024
Cryptology, the science of secure communication, uses mathematical techniques to encrypt and decrypt messages, ensuring confidentiality and integrity in communication channels. From ancient ciphers to modern encryption algorithms, cryptology has evolved over centuries to meet the ever-changing needs of information security.
Encryption and Decryption
Encryption involves converting plaintext (unencrypted) data into ciphertext (encrypted) data using an encryption algorithm and a secret key. Decryption, on the other hand, is the process of converting ciphertext back into plaintext using a decryption algorithm and the same secret key.
Modern encryption algorithms use complex mathematical operations and cryptographic techniques to ensure the security and confidentiality of encrypted data. These algorithms rely on the difficulty of certain mathematical problems, such as factoring large prime numbers or computing discrete logarithms, to prevent unauthorized access to encrypted information.
Public-Key Cryptography
Public-key cryptography, also known as asymmetric cryptography, is a cryptographic technique that uses a pair of keys: a public key for encryption and a private key for decryption. The public key can be freely distributed, allowing anyone to encrypt messages, while the private key is kept secret and used for decryption.
Public-key cryptography enables secure communication over insecure channels, such as the internet, by allowing parties to exchange encrypted messages without sharing a secret key. Popular public-key encryption algorithms include RSA (Rivest-Shamir-Adleman) and Elliptic Curve Cryptography (ECC).
Applications of Cryptology
Cryptology has applications across various domains, including military communication, financial transactions, and data protection. In military and intelligence operations, cryptology is used to secure classified information and protect sensitive communications from interception and decryption by adversaries.
In the realm of finance, cryptology underpins the security of electronic transactions, online banking, and digital currencies such as Bitcoin. Cryptographic protocols such as SSL/TLS (Secure Sockets Layer/Transport Layer Security) ensure the confidentiality, integrity, and authenticity of data exchanged over the internet.
Challenges and Advances
As technology evolves, cryptology faces new challenges and threats, such as quantum computing and cyberattacks. Quantum computers have the potential to break many existing encryption algorithms by exploiting their inherent parallelism and computational power.
To address these challenges, researchers are developing new cryptographic techniques and algorithms that are resistant to quantum attacks. Post-quantum cryptography, also known as quantum-resistant cryptography, aims to design encryption algorithms that remain secure even in the presence of quantum computers.
Conclusion
Cryptology plays a vital role in ensuring the security and privacy of digital communication in an increasingly interconnected world. By leveraging mathematical principles and cryptographic techniques, cryptologists safeguard sensitive information and protect against cyber threats.
As we continue to rely on digital technologies for communication, commerce, and critical infrastructure, the importance of cryptology in safeguarding our digital assets and preserving privacy cannot be overstated. For in the realm of cryptology, mathematics serves as the foundation of secrecy and security in the digital age.